The most common measure of central tendency is the mean, or average, but the median (the middle value) and mode (the most frequent value) are equally important, especially when dealing with skewed distributions or outliers. Qualitative data describes qualities or characteristics, such as colors or opinions, while quantitative data involves numerical values that can be measured or counted.
